    Abstract: An agricultural vehicle includes a chassis and an engine, transmission and operator station which are each carried by the chassis. The engine has a maximum operating speed. The transmission includes a continuously variable output. A power/economy switch which is positioned within the operator station provides a first output signal indicative of a power mode and a second output signal indicative of an economy mode. A controller is coupled with each of the engine, the transmission and the power/economy switch. The controller receives the second output signal from the power/economy switch and controls each of the engine and the transmission to be in an economy mode, whereby an operating speed of the engine is limited to a reduced maximum speed which is below the maximum operating speed, and the continuously variable output of the transmission is increased to offset for the reduction in engine operating speed.

    Abstract: The control of an apparatus within a grain holding device for feeding grain to an unloader conveyor operable for conveying the grain from the holding device, includes sensing a predetermined condition or conditions representative of capacity of the unloader conveyor for receiving grain, and adaptively controlling the apparatus for feeding grain to the unloader conveyor in advantageous varying manners responsive to the conditions, including to delay initiation of feeding until the receiving capacity is increased, and to match the grain feed to the capacity. The automatic control can be overridden, to allow user control of unloader speed, and can be configured to allow cleanout of the unloader conveyor.

    Abstract: An unloader control for an unloader conveyor and grain tank conveyor of an agricultural combine, which, when an unload command is received, will automatically initiate operation of the unloader conveyor to commence conveying grain in an inlet end thereof toward the outlet end thereof so as to allow smooth transition of grain from the grain tank conveyer to the inlet end of the unloader conveyor, then automatically initiate operation of the grain tank conveyor for moving grain into the inlet end of the unloader conveyor, and, when a clean out command is received during operation of the unloader conveyor and the grain tank conveyor, will automatically cease operation of the grain tank conveyor, then, after a sufficient time period for the unloader conveyor to convey substantially all of any grain therein through the outlet end, automatically cease operation of the unloader conveyor.

    Abstract: An integrated combine reel drive system for an agricultural vehicle such as a combine harvester, the drive system having the features of a single integrated hydraulic circuit for activating multiple hydraulic devices carried by the agricultural vehicle. The integrated circuit includes a header circuit, wherein the header circuit includes a steering circuit, an implement circuit, and a reel circuit. The header circuit includes two valve stacks for operating multiple hydraulic devices which enables the integrated circuit to drive the multiple hydraulic devices using manageable hydraulic pressures. Specifically, the integrated hydraulic circuit activates a hydraulic power steering mechanism, a hydraulic header adjusting apparatus and other hydraulic devices associated with the header, a hydraulic drive for the reel, and a hydraulic positioning mechanism for the reel of an agricultural vehicle.
